Abstract
La invención se refiere a un neumático (100) para vehículos que comprende al menos un elemento estructural que comprende un material elastomérico vulcanizado obtenido vulcanizando una composición elastomérica vulcanizable que comprende al menos un polímero elastomérico de dieno vulcanizable y al menos un relleno de refuerzo compuesto, un proceso para producir un neumático (100) que comprende el relleno de refuerzo compuesto, un masterbatch que comprende el relleno de refuerzo compuesto y un proceso para producir el mismo, así como un proceso para producir el relleno de refuerzo compuesto.
